1/2 - 1/4x ≥ -1/4
Combine 1/4x to get x/4:
1/2 - x/4 ≥ -1/4
Subtract 1/2 from both sides:
-x/4 ≥ -1/4 - 1/2
Simplify:
-x/4 ≥ -3/4
Multiply both sides by 4:
-x ≥ -3/4 * 4
-x ≥ -3
Multiply each side by -1 ( and since you are multiplying by -1, you also need to reverse the inequality sign)
Answer: x ≤ 3

Step-by-step explanation:
The figure shows a triangle whose;
- Base AC is 8 units
- Height is 5 units
We are supposed to get its area;
Area of a triangle is given by the formula;
Area = 0.5×b×h
Thus;
Area = 0.5 × 8 units × 5 units
= 20 square units
Hence, the area of the figure is 20 square units
